These GTPases are activated by guanine nucleotide-exchange factors (GEFs). A biochemical search for Cdc42 activators led to the cloning of zizimin1, a new protein whose overexpression induces Cdc42 activation. Sequence comparison combined with mutational analysis identified a new domain, which we named CZH2, that mediates direct interaction with Cdc42. CZH2-containing proteins constitute a new superfamily that includes the so-called 'CDM' proteins that bind to and activate Rac. Together, the results suggest that CZH2 is a new GEF domain for the Rho family of proteins.","is_dataset_classified":null,"base_score":5.153291594497779,"endowment":5.153291594497779,"datacite_reuse_total":0,"file_count":0,"downloads":0,"views":0,"has_version_chain":false,"is_dataset":false,"is_oa":false,"pmid":"12172552","pmcid":null,"openalex_id":"https://openalex.org/W1980943495","authors":[],"funders":[{"funder_name":"NIGMS NIH HHS","grant_id":"R01 GM41721","title":null}],"total_grants":1,"fwci":4.1535,"citation_percentile":0.94252874,"influential_citations":0,"citation_trend":[{"year":2012,"count":13},{"year":2013,"count":7},{"year":2014,"count":7},{"year":2015,"count":4},{"year":2016,"count":2},{"year":2017,"count":6},{"year":2018,"count":3},{"year":2019,"count":3},{"year":2020,"count":10},{"year":2021,"count":4},{"year":2022,"count":5},{"year":2023,"count":1},{"year":2024,"count":3},{"year":2026,"count":3}],"oa_status":"closed","license":"http://www.springer.com/tdm","oa_locations":[{"url":"http://www.nature.com/articles/ncb835.pdf","host_type":"publisher"},{"url":"http://www.nature.com/articles/ncb835","host_type":"publisher"},{"url":"https://doi.org/10.1038/ncb835","host_type":"journal"},{"url":"https://pubmed.ncbi.nlm.nih.gov/12172552","host_type":"repository"}],"fields_of_study":["Cellular Mechanics and Interactions","Microtubule and mitosis dynamics","Protein Kinase Regulation and GTPase Signaling"],"mesh_terms":["Amino Acid Sequence","Animals","Binding Sites","Cloning, Molecular","Enzyme Activation","Humans","Molecular Sequence Data","RNA, Messenger","Tissue Distribution","3T3 Cells","Sequence Homology, Amino Acid","Protein Structure, Tertiary","Guanine Nucleotide Exchange Factors","rho GTP-Binding Proteins","cdc42 GTP-Binding Protein","Mice"],"keywords":["CDC42","Guanine nucleotide exchange factor","GTPase","Cell biology","Actin cytoskeleton","DOCK","Biology","Effector","Activator (genetics)","Rac GTP-Binding Proteins","RAC1","Cytoskeleton","Chemistry","Gene","Genetics","Cell","Signal transduction"],"sdg_mappings":[],"linked_datasets":[],"clinical_trials":[],"software_tools":[],"database_accessions":[],"source":"live","citation_network_status":"fetched"},"created_at":"2026-08-04T00:50:07.319208Z","pmid":null,"pmcid":null,"fwci":null,"citation_percentile":null,"influential_citations":0,"oa_status":null,"license":null,"views":0,"total_file_size_bytes":0,"version_count":0,"fair_f":null,"fair_a":null,"fair_i":null,"fair_r":null,"fair_zscore":null,"fair_rationale":null,"fair_model":null,"fair_agent_version":null,"fair_fulltext_source":null,"fair_has_llm":null,"fair_computed_at":null,"clinical_trials":[],"software_tools":[],"db_accessions":[],"linked_datasets":[],"topics":[]}
